2008 Summer Learning Program
Young Warrior's Learning Institute
On August 1, 2008 we finished our first summer learning program called the Young Warrior’s Learning Institute. This was an 8 week academic enrichment program conducted by Group Excellence. The program ran over the student’s summer vacation. This program was offered to the students living in and around the Hamilton Park Community of Dallas. Over the summer the children were instructed in Math, Science, Nutrition and fundamentals of Spanish. But in addition, there were some life skills included in the curriculum. They were schooled in the value of service through volunteerism and leadership. They even had a volunteer project to complete for the Children's Medical Center of Dallas.
One thing that we tried to do was to link their academic studies to the prospects of a better career and their impact on society. We wanted to show them where a good education could take them. They went on 2 field trips. They went to a Hensel Phelps major high rise construction site and to a Lockheed Martin aerospace plant. Both of these companies hosted the kids and exposed them to technical careers in engineering and science. Our goal was to make math, science and education in general, relevant to their possible future careers.
